The 1996 4 coin gold proof sovereign set set contains a gold proof five pounds (£5), two pounds (£2), sovereign and half sovereign. Benedetto Pistrucci's famous portrayal of St. George slaying the dragon is depicted on each of the reverses. Queen Elizabeth II's third portrait can be seen on the obverse of all four coins, designed by Raphael Maklouf. The four coins are all made of solid 22 carat gold (Gold fineness of 0.916), and are housed in their original Royal Mint acrylic screw top capsules. The coins are presented in their Royal Mint red leatherette presentation case, accompanied with an individually numbered certificate of authenticity. The set includes a gold plated medallion showing a crowned 'Elizabeth R' with the date '1996'. The reverse depicts a Rat, the Chinese new year animal for 1996. Only 742 1996 4 coin gold proof sovereign set were issued by the Royal Mint. Please see the table below for individual coin weights:| Coin | Weight (Grams) |
| Five Pounds | 39.94 |
| Two Pounds | 15.98 |
| Sovereign | 7.98 |
| Half Sovereign | 3.99 |
